Policies and storage practices
Privacy Policy
Last Updated: May 28, 2026
Introduction
This Privacy Policy outlines how the AestherBot Discord Bot ("the Bot", "AestherBot", "we", "us", "our") collects, uses, stores, and protects user data when you interact with our service. Ownership Notice: AestherBot is owned and operated by AestheticSpartan. By using the Bot, you consent to the data practices described in this policy.
Data Collection
The Bot collects and processes the following data to provide its services:
1. User & Server Information
- Discord User IDs: Used for collecting, inventory, economy, leveling, pets, achievements, settings, voting, moderation of game features, and command interactions.
- Discord Server (Guild) IDs: Used for per-server configuration such as spawn channels, announce channels, ping roles, and reaction roles.
- Command Interaction History: Basic information about which commands are used, by whom, and in which servers, used to deliver functionality and improve features.
2. Game & Feature Data
- Collection Data: Your collected items, inventory contents, collection progress, favorites, and wishlist. Stored with your User ID.
- Economy Data: Gold wallet and bank balances, bank upgrade level, P-Coins, transaction history, gambling statistics, and marketplace listings/trades. Stored with your User ID.
- Progression Data: Account level and XP, skill levels and skill XP, achievements, badges, titles, daily/weekly/monthly streaks, and active buffs. Stored with your User ID.
- Pet Data: Hatched pets, hatchery/hospital/workstation state, pet battle records and arena rankings, and pet inventory. Stored with your User ID.
- Farming Data: Farm plots, crops, and growth state. Stored with your User ID.
- Settings & Cooldowns: Per-user preferences (spawn pings, DM reminders, profile customisation) and command cooldown timestamps.
3. Vote Data (via Top.gg)
- When you vote on Top.gg, we receive your Discord User ID via a webhook.
- We store your User ID, the timestamp of your last vote, your current vote streak, and your preference for vote reminders. Stored persistently until data deletion is requested.
4. Supporter (Patreon & Ko-fi) Data
- When Patreon links your supporter role to Discord, we detect your tier via your Discord role(s) and store your tier, associated role and guild IDs, and reward markers (welcome and weekly stipend tracking) so rewards are granted correctly and not duplicated.
- Reward grants are recorded in an append-only reward log tied to your User ID for accounting and support.
How We Use Your Data
Your data is used solely to:
- Provide core bot functionality (commands, spawns, interactions, configuration).
- Manage game systems (collection, inventory, economy, banking, gambling, pets, farming, skills, achievements, marketplace).
- Track votes, calculate streaks, award Voter Chests, and send reminders.
- Detect supporter tiers and distribute the correct Patreon/Ko-fi rewards.
- Calculate leaderboards and distribute rewards.
- Improve Bot functionality by analyzing aggregated, anonymized usage data.
Data Storage and Security
Where Data Is Stored
Persistent data is stored in a PostgreSQL database hosted on Supabase. Static game catalogs (items, achievements, useables) are defined in configuration and mirrored into the database.
Duration of Storage
- Game & Economy Data: Stored indefinitely until cleared by the user or a deletion request.
- Vote & Supporter Data: Stored indefinitely until deletion is requested.
- Spawn State: Stored temporarily for operational needs and cleaned up on restart.
Backup System
The Bot maintains backups of persistent user data for disaster recovery. A limited number of recent backups are retained.
Data Security
We implement reasonable technical and administrative security measures to protect your data from unauthorized access, alteration, disclosure, or destruction. No online service can be 100% secure.
Third-Party Services
The Bot utilizes third-party services that may process your data:
- Discord API: Required for all bot interactions. Subject to Discord's Privacy Policy.
- Top.gg API & Webhooks: Tracks votes, streaks, and rewards. Subject to Top.gg's policies.
- Supabase (PostgreSQL hosting): Stores persistent bot data. Subject to Supabase's privacy and security policies.
- Patreon & Ko-fi: Process voluntary contributions and, in Patreon's case, supply supporter role information via Discord. Subject to their respective privacy policies.
Your Rights
You have the right to:
- Request access to stored game data (for example via
/profile,/inventoryand/checkprogress). - Request deletion of your game data (contact the development team).
- Disable vote and cooldown reminders through
/settingsor provided buttons. - Opt out by removing the Bot from your server or discontinuing use.
- Contact us with questions or concerns about your data.
Data Deletion
- Collection, economy, pet, farming, achievement, and progression data can be deleted upon request.
- Server administrators can manage per-guild configuration (spawn channels, ping roles, reaction roles, premium channels).
- Vote and reminder preferences can be updated via
/settingsor buttons; full vote history deletion requires contacting the development team.
AI in Development
To aid in the development, maintenance, and improvement of AestherBot, AestheticSpartan may use artificial intelligence (AI) tools to assist with code generation, analysis, refactoring, and documentation. Any code or assets produced with AI assistance for the Bot remain the intellectual property of AestheticSpartan. AestherBot does not send your personal data to AI services as part of normal gameplay.
Changes to This Policy
We may update this Privacy Policy from time to time. Significant changes will be communicated by updating this page and potentially via in-bot announcements.
Legal Basis for Processing
- Consent: Provided when you add the Bot or use commands that require data processing.
- Legitimate Interest: Necessary to provide the Bot's core functionality, anti-abuse systems, and improvements.
- Performance of a Contract (Implicit): We process data to provide the services you request by interacting with the Bot.
Contact Information
For questions about this Privacy Policy or your data, please contact AestheticSpartan through:
- The official Bot support server (link usually available via
/helpor/info). - Our website: https://spartanbots.github.io/AestherBot/privacy.html
By using AestherBot, you acknowledge that you have read and understand this Privacy Policy and agree to its terms.